Hearth tile installation involves placing durable, heat-resistant tiles in areas where fireplaces, wood stoves, or heating mantels are used. This service includes preparing the surface, selecting appropriate materials, and expertly laying the tiles to ensure a secure and attractive finish. Proper installation not only enhances the overall look of a living space but also provides a protective barrier against heat and potential sparks, helping to maintain a safe and functional fireplace area.
This service can help address common problems such as cracked or damaged tiles, uneven surfaces, or outdated styles that no longer match the interior decor. Over time, heat exposure and daily use can cause tiles to loosen or break, leading to safety concerns or aesthetic issues. Replacing or repairing hearth tiles with professional installation ensures the area remains both safe and visually appealing, reducing the risk of fire hazards and improving the overall durability of the fireplace surround.

The overview below groups typical Hearth Tile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Topeka, KS.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or hearth tile repairs or replacement of a few damaged tiles,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on tile type and accessibility.
Partial Installations - When replacing or installing hearth tiles in a specific area or section, costs generally range from $600 to $2,000. Larger, more complex partial projects can reach higher, but most projects stay within this middle band.
Full Hearth Replacement - A complete overhaul of the hearth with new tile installation often costs between $2,000 and $5,000. Larger or more intricate designs may push costs beyond this range, though fewer projects reach the highest tiers.
Custom or High-End Projects - Custom tile work or premium materials can lead to costs exceeding $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ve detailed design work or high-end materials, making them the upper end of typical exp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of hearth tiles do local contractors install? They install a variety of hearth tiles including ceramic, porcelain, natural stone, and glass options to suit different styles and functional needs.
Can local service providers customize hearth tile designs? Yes, many contractors offer custom design options to match specific aesthetic preferences and complement existing interior decor.
Are there specific hearth tile materials recommended for high-heat areas? Heat-resistant materials such as natural stone and certain ceramics are commonly recommended for hearths to withstand high temperatures safely.
Do local contractors handle both indoor and outdoor hearth tile installations? Yes, experienced service providers can install hearth tiles in both indoor fireplaces and outdoor fire pits or fireplaces.
What preparation is needed before installing hearth tiles? Preparation typically involves cleaning the surface, ensuring proper leveling, and sometimes repairing or reinforcing the underlying structure for a durable installation.
